Laying and backing bets are two sides of the same coin. When you lay a bet, you are essentially taking the position of a bookmaker. You offer odds against an event occurring and stand to profit if the outcome you predict doesn't materialize. Conversely, when you back a bet, you are betting in favor of an event happening and stand to win if your prediction is correct.
